Output 943c97ab06ced7f5e25f175f59abcebaca147a9c72fcbfa21d21f9c39b45d0e8:6

value
41738225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f3664eb1afe7a0e3a2da078585c5b76b876926b OP_EQUAL
address
MNQzqJnDTTAvedSrnaUyNkfT9gdvMsXC5y
transaction
943c97ab06ced7f5e25f175f59abcebaca147a9c72fcbfa21d21f9c39b45d0e8
spent
true